/// Deserializes a Request from an IO stream of JSON.
///
/// # Example
///
/// ```rust,no_run
/// use lambda_http::request::from_reader;
/// use std::fs::File;
/// use std::error::Error;
///
/// fn main() -> Result<(), Box<dyn Error>> {
/// let request = from_reader(
/// File::open("path/to/request.json")?
/// )?;
/// Ok(println!("{:#?}", request))
/// }
/// ```
pub fn from_reader<R>(rdr: R) -> Result<crate::Request, JsonError>
where
R: Read,
{
serde_json::from_reader(rdr).map(LambdaRequest::into)
}

/// Deserializes a Request from a string of JSON text.
///
/// # Example
///
/// ```rust,no_run
/// use lambda_http::request::from_str;
/// use std::fs::File;
/// use std::error::Error;
///
/// fn main() -> Result<(), Box<dyn Error>> {
/// let request = from_str(
/// r#"{ ...raw json here... }"#
/// )?;
/// Ok(println!("{:#?}", request))
/// }
/// ```
pub fn from_str(s: &str) -> Result<crate::Request, JsonError> {
serde_json::from_str(s).map(LambdaRequest::into)
}
